The nose intrigues with its aromas of black currant, dark cherry, graphite and exotic spice. The entry is smooth and subtle, with a firm, focused palate showing flavours of blackberry, perfumed black tea, oregano and hints of cedar.
The mid-plate is linear and elegant with exquisite structure and fine-grained, supple tannins. Vibrant yet integrated acidity and a charcoal-edged texture create complexity in an exceptionally balanced wine. Blueberry, pencil lead and bay leaf linger on a fresh, precise finish with hints of cocoa.
